Problem

Traditional electronic candles lack ornamental value and safety concerns, failing to provide a dynamic and stereoscopic lighting experience.

Innovation Solution

A rotary electronic candle with a rocking candle wick featuring a hollow cavity, motor-driven rotating shaft, LED light source, and hemispherical cover that refracts light, combined with dynamic graphics on a translucent outer layer, creating a dynamic and three-dimensional lighting effect.

AI summary

A rotary electronic candle, including a candle body having a hollow cavity with a candle wick, the candle wick including a battery box base, a plurality of fixing columns, a motor fixing ring, a cover plate, a motor, a rotating shaft, a light source plate and a hemispherical cover. The fixing columns are fixed at the upper end of the battery box base, the motor fixing ring is located between the plurality of fixing columns, and the cover plate is covered on the upper end face of the motor fixing ring. A through hole is formed in the center of the cover plate, the motor is installed in the motor fixing ring, the rotating shaft is connected with the motor shaft of the motor and penetrates through the through hole, and the light source plate is fixed on the cover plate.
